Latest Patents

Willert holds a patent for a transmitted-light illuminating device designed for microscopes. This device consists of a condenser, an iris-aperture diaphragm, and a turret. The turret allows for the interchangeable mounting of auxiliary lenses or diaphragms, enabling the illumination of large-object fields. Additionally, the microscope can be utilized in phase contrast. The design integrates the condenser, diaphragm, and turret into a single unit, ensuring that the turret is functionally coupled to the iris diaphragm. This innovative mechanism allows for precise control over the diaphragm and turret positioning, enhancing the overall performance of the microscope.
